🔌 The Hidden Challenge of Renewables: Voltage Stability in an IBR-Dominated Grid ⚡ As grids transition to high renewable penetration, voltage stability is becoming a growing challenge. Unlike synchronous generators, IBRs (solar, wind, batteries): ⚡ Provide low short-circuit current, weakening grid stiffness. ⚡ Are current-limited, reducing dynamic voltage support. ⚡ Use PLL-based control, which can destabilize weak grids. Even with Fault Ride-Through (FRT) & reactive power support, IBRs don’t fully replace synchronous machines in ensuring grid voltage stability. 🛠 Solutions We Need: ✅ Grid-Forming Inverters → Provide voltage & frequency support. ✅ Synchronous Condensers → Restore reactive power & inertia. ✅ STATCOMs & FACTS → Fast dynamic voltage control. ✅ Stronger Transmission & Monitoring → Improve system resilience. The shift to renewables is inevitable—but without stability measures, we risk voltage collapse & power disruptions. What’s the best way forward—grid-forming inverters or hybrid solutions? How an HVDC (High Voltage Direct Current) system works ? 1️⃣ The process begins at an offshore wind farm, where wind turbines generate electricity in the form of #AlternatingCurrent (AC). 2️⃣ AC power is transmitted to an offshore converter platform. Here, the AC is converted into #DirectCurrent (DC), why? → DC is more efficient for long-distance transmission. 3️⃣ DC power then travels through underwater cables (specially designed to carry high-voltage #DC power) to reach the onshore station. 4️⃣ Once the DC power reaches the onshore station, DC is converted back into AC, why? → power grid and most appliances use AC power. 5️⃣ Finally, #AC #power is supplied to an onshore substation and distributed to the grid, where it can be used by consumers (you 🫵🏽) 💡 This process allows for efficient transmission of electricity from remote renewable energy sources - like offshore #windfarms - to onshore grids where it can be utilized. It’s a key technology for integrating renewable energy into the power grid ♻ GE Vernova's Electrification businesses provides #HVDC #technology solutions for connecting #offshore #windenergy production to #onshore electrical #grids using HVDC systems. 💚 GE Vernova

🔋 The Role of HVDC (High Voltage Direct Current) in Long-Distance Transmission High Voltage Direct Current (HVDC) technology is revolutionizing long-distance power transmission. Here’s why HVDC is crucial for the future of our energy infrastructure: 1. Reduced Transmission Losses ⚡ HVDC systems minimize energy losses over long distances compared to traditional AC systems, ensuring more efficient power delivery and reduced waste. 2. Increased Stability and Control 🌐 HVDC allows for precise control of power flows, enhancing grid stability and enabling the integration of diverse energy sources, including renewables. 3. Long-Distance Efficiency 🌍 HVDC is ideal for transmitting electricity over vast distances, connecting remote renewable energy sources, such as offshore wind farms, to major consumption centers. 4. Cost-Effectiveness 💰 While the initial investment in HVDC infrastructure can be high, the long-term benefits of reduced losses and increased efficiency lead to significant cost savings. 5. Enhanced Grid Integration 🌱 HVDC technology facilitates the integration of renewable energy into the grid, supporting the transition to a more sustainable and resilient energy system. 6. Cross-Border Connections 🌐 HVDC enables efficient cross-border power trading, enhancing energy security and cooperation between countries by linking different power grids. 7. Lower Environmental Impact 🌳 By reducing the need for additional power generation and minimizing losses, HVDC contributes to lower greenhouse gas emissions and a smaller environmental footprint. 8. Flexibility in Transmission 🚀 HVDC systems can be easily adapted to changing energy demands and technological advancements, making them a future-proof solution for evolving energy needs. HVDC technology is a cornerstone of modern power transmission, providing efficient, reliable, and sustainable solutions for the energy challenges of today and tomorrow.
